Output 685f860b54b940c4e93497405b55223356281174ee44150ea801d138c82742bb:3

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ef142547862eecebfec3ff89f5fcfd852a5fb5 OP_EQUAL
address
3JBhxYyWDVxoWBp7nAyexBHEj19LKptgvB
transaction
685f860b54b940c4e93497405b55223356281174ee44150ea801d138c82742bb
spent
true